Attenborough explores the planet's undersea habitats, revealing the greatest age of ocean discovery and emphasizing the ocean's vital importance while exposing its problems and highlighting opportunities for marine life recovery.
"Ocean with David Attenborough is a documentary that, as the name suggests, takes viewers on a journey through the importance of biodiversity in the world's oceans, guided by the renowned British naturalist and broadcaster. With stunning and impactful images—some of which can be disheartening—the documentary explores the planet’s remarkable aquatic biodiversity and details the current state of ocean pollution, destruction, and its consequences for the ongoing climate crisis. However, it also offers hope, providing vital information to raise awareness and help make better decisions toward reversing climate change. Whether or not you enjoy nature documentaries (with the always phenomenal guidance of Attenborough), this film is crucial for understanding the current state of our planet."
